Important Information
Travel flat, paved roads to reach the flat, gravel driveway at this mountain property, with a carport for 2 and enough parking for up to 6 vehicles total. Note there are 12 steps up to reach the front porch and the main level; however, you can pull a car up the small gravel hill if needed, where the other side of the porch only has 2 steps.

Keep in mind the staircase to the lower level, where the game room and one of the bathrooms are located, is steep.

CFY Quality Rating System

Bronze

Overall outdated and/or has worn out elements. There is little to no coordination in furniture and decor. Most furniture items are of lower quality such as cloth couches, laminate countertops, and particle board cabinets.

  • Laminate Countertops
  • Tube TVS
  • Cloth or outdated couches/chairs
  • Brass head/footboards
  • Worn out furniture
  • Outdated kitchen appliances
  • Worn or Outdated Carpet
  • Mismatch furniture
  • Visible wear on deck/exterior

Silver

Average quality accommodations. Will have some good quality and some low quality elements. Things such as a mixture of flatscreen and tube tvs, good quality furniture but worn out and not consistent, particle board cabinets and laminate countertops with updated appliances, or updated appliances but not consistent. These properties have elements of a Bronze and Gold level.

Gold

Good quality accommodations. These properties are high quality, but all elements might not be considered luxury in nature. There might be more wear on furniture, deck/exterior, etc. TVs are flat screen, but might not be the newest in quality. Might have stone countertops with updated appliances that aren’t stainless steel. These properties have some elements of the Platinum level, but elements are either slightly outdated, worn, or not as high quality.

Platinum

Luxury accommodations. All elements are of high quality, design, and are up-to-date. Consistent furniture and decor in each room. Unique touches such as stone designs, barnwood/shiplap, full log pillars are often found in these properties.
